On September 6, 1942, [1]: 61 Ankers married Richard Denning, to whom she remained married until her death in 1985. The couple had one child, Diana Denning (later Dwyer). [2] Ankers moved to Hawaii when her husband accepted the role of the governor in Hawaii 5-0. [4] She died of ovarian cancer at the age of 67 on August 29, 1985, in Maui. [2]

In 1942, Denning married 1940s horror film queen Evelyn Ankers [4] (co-star of The Wolf Man, Ghost of Frankenstein and Son of Dracula), who retired from films at the age of 32 after they were married. He and Ankers had a daughter, Diana Denning (later Dwyer). [13]
No Greater Love is a 1960 film starring Evelyn Ankers and Richard Denning and is notable for being Ankers', as well as Art Linkletter's, last movie. External links
Black Beauty is a 1946 American drama film directed by Max Nosseck and starring Mona Freeman, Richard Denning, and Evelyn Ankers. It is based on Anna Sewell 's 1877 novel of the same name . Plot
